Headline: "The Necessity of Vital Vitamins and Minerals in Strengthening the Adults' Immune System"

Our immune system is our body's defense shield against harmful microorganisms..

A healthy immune system destroys those intruders keeping us in good condition. To guarantee it performs effectively, it requires numerous essential vitamins and minerals. These are especially important for adults, whose immune systems may get more info weaken with age.

Key vitamins for the adult immune system include the likes of Vitamin A, B6, C, D, and E. Each plays a critical role in maintaining our body's defenses.

Vitamin A, the real hero when it comes to boosting our body's defenses. It boosts the health of our skin, which are our first line of defense against germs.

Vitamin B6, however, is essential for supporting chemical reactions. This makes it a crucial vitamin for maximum immune health.

Vitamin C is perhaps the most famous vitamin for immunity. It increases the generation of white blood cells, which are key for combating diseases.

Next up is Vitamin D, a large number of adults are deficient in. This vitamin is vital for promoting immune function, notably in relation to respiratory health.

Lastly, Vitamin E is a powerful antioxidant that supports in shielding the body against the impacts of free radicals. It also enhances the function of immune cells which are necessary to ward off illnesses.

Minerals too contribute importantly in our immune health. Zinc, selenium, iron, and copper, for example, are all necessary for various aspects of the immune system. They bolster immunity, aid in healing, and can even catalyze the generation of new immune cells.

In conclusion, a well-maintained intake of these vitamins and minerals can tremendously benefit the adult immune system. This keeps it ready to defend against potential poor health, helping to ensure well-being. Hence, maintaining a balanced diet or considering targeted supplements can be a pivotal step toward supporting our immunity.
